Last Saturday hundreds of guests gathered for the open house at SolarWorld to learn more about the factory, the company and solar energy.

The new SolarWorld $440 million plant will be home to SolarWorld Industries America headquarters for SolarWorld AG of Germany, one of the largest solar-cell producers in the world. The plant just opened last Friday, October 17, and by 2011 it is expected to produce material each year capable of generating enough electricity to power 80,000 U.S. homes.

This translates in to $400 million directly invested in Oregon’s economy, 1,000 new jobs by 2011, and will allow us to set an example in affordable and efficient energy alternatives.
